亚洲国产一区二区三区亚瑟_亚洲熟女少妇精品_亚洲国产精品久久久久秋霞小说_午夜福利啪啪无遮挡免费_国产成年女人毛片80s网站_成人av鲁丝片一区二区免费

焦點 >

天天即時看!kubernetes-Deployment介紹(一)

時間:2023-05-01 12:14:02       來源:騰訊云


(資料圖片僅供參考)

一、概述

Kubernetes是一種容器編排平臺,提供了一系列的對象和API,幫助用戶管理和部署容器應用程序。其中一個核心概念是Deployment,它是一種Kubernetes中的高級別控制器,可用于管理Pod和ReplicaSet,以確保應用程序的高可用性。

二、Deployment的概念

在Kubernetes中,Deployment是一種高級別控制器,用于管理Pod和ReplicaSet。Deployment提供了一種聲明性的方式來創建和更新Pod和ReplicaSet,可以確保應用程序的高可用性。

Deployment使用了ReplicaSet來創建和管理Pod,ReplicaSet是一種Kubernetes對象,用于確保在任何時間點都有指定數量的Pod副本正在運行。Deployment可以根據需要調整ReplicaSet的數量,以確保Pod的數量符合指定數量。

Deployment還支持滾動升級,可以逐步升級應用程序而不會影響服務。Deployment還支持回滾操作,可以快速恢復應用程序到先前的版本。

三、使用Deployment進行應用程序部署

下面是一個使用Deployment進行應用程序部署的示例:

apiVersion: apps/v1kind: Deploymentmetadata:  name: my-deploymentspec:  replicas: 3  selector:    matchLabels:      app: my-app  template:    metadata:      labels:        app: my-app    spec:      containers:      - name: my-container        image: my-image:latest        ports:        - containerPort: 8080

在上述示例中,我們使用Deployment創建了一個名為“my-deployment”的部署,它包含3個Pod副本。Deployment還指定了標簽選擇器,以便可以選擇與應用程序相關的Pod。此外,我們還指定了容器的名稱、鏡像和端口。

使用Deployment進行應用程序部署的過程如下:

創建Deployment對象:使用kubectl apply命令創建Deployment對象。創建ReplicaSet對象:Deployment創建一個ReplicaSet對象,用于管理Pod副本。創建Pod對象:ReplicaSet根據指定的副本數量創建Pod對象。更新應用程序:如果需要更新應用程序,可以更新“my-image”鏡像的版本,并通過kubectl apply命令將新版本的鏡像部署到集群中。實現滾動升級:Deployment支持滾動升級,可以逐步升級應用程序而不會影響服務。使用kubectl set image命令可以實現滾動升級。回滾應用程序:Deployment可以回滾應用程序到先前的版本,以便在出現問題時快速恢復應用程序。

關鍵詞:

首頁
頻道
底部
頂部
主站蜘蛛池模板: 91久久久久 | 97超级碰 | 欧美日韩一区二区三区不卡 | 午夜免费视频 | 欧美a网站 | 四虎成人精品在永久免费 | 久久99精品国产麻豆婷婷洗澡 | 日韩黄色精品视频 | 亚洲精品视频网 | 香蕉毛片视频 | 一本到免费视频 | 久久6精品 | 久久综合热 | 久久精品久久久久久 | 在线视频一区二区三区 | 欧美日韩第一页 | 宅男噜噜噜| 在线日韩一区二区 | 精品一二三区 | 国产一区二区三区影院 | 久久影视中文字幕 | 午夜色综合 | 成年人网站在线观看视频 | 夜色综合 | 亚洲色图欧美视频 | 免费观看一级黄色片 | 婷婷91| 亚洲爱爱视频 | 久久精品视频网站 | 五月婷婷色丁香 | 日本一区二区在线视频 | 午夜欧美精品 | 一区二区三区在线观看免费视频 | 亚洲精品久久久久久 | 超碰在线综合 | 中国特黄一级片 | 亚欧视频在线观看 | 专业操老外 | 日韩中文字幕精品 | 五月婷婷丁香 | 日本a一级 |